Electronic Configuration of Hydrogen

Hydrogen, its electron arrangement, is one end of scientific inquiry. Hydrogen atoms are simple and microscopic, containing only one electron. The state of their electrons is logically distributed in the energy level.

According to various theories, the electrons of hydrogen are often in the ground state, and the electron arrangement formula is 1s. This "1" indicates the main quantum number where the electron is located, indicating its energy layer; the "s" is the image of the angular quantum number, indicating that the shape of the electron cloud is spherical; the "1" on the upper right represents the number of electrons in the energy state.

When a hydrogen atom is energized, electrons can jump to a high-energy state, which is unstable and immediately returns to the ground state, and releases energy in the form of light.
